About This Item
New York: Hudson Hills Press, 2002. Hardcover. VG/VG. Royal blue cloth, dark & illus. dust jacket, 285 pp. 95 color and 57 bw plates. "Edwin Dickinson (1891-1978) was a representational painter highly regarded by his abstract expressionist contemporaries, who included his work in many of their group exhibitions." (dj) This is the largest, most definitive book on this outstanding and very important 20th century American painter. Already a classic that went out of print quickly.
